Cedar Fair appoints former owner's daughter to GM post at Michigan's Adventure

Posted | Contributed by ST chick

Cedar Fair announced that Camille Jourden-Mark, the daughter of the former owner of Michigan's Adventure, has been appointed general manager of the park her family used to own. She replaces Larry MacKenzie, who will move on to Valleyfair and Camp Snoopy at the Mall of America. Jourden-Mark is the only female and youngest GM in the Cedar Fair chain at age 35.
